So far ;-)The Cynical Sailorh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/11047491682363507834no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-1717926498377706091.post-53185040203038312332017-01-26T09:47:11.171-08:002017-01-26T09:47:11.171-08:00Actually, the leaks weren't due to the rubber ...Actually, the leaks weren't due to the rubber seal itself. They were in okay shape. The previous owner had applied some sort of hard sealant around the seal to address the leaks. What they should have done was removed the seal, removed the old silicone, put new silicone in and reattached the seal. His fix didn't address the issue which was that the seals just needed to be rebedded with silicone. Scott heated the seal to loosen the old crap that was put on so that it wouldn't tear the seal by pulling it off. The heat hasn't affected the seal and they were in good enough condition to reuse. We've since tested and our fix seems to work - no more leaks.
